The anticipated Trump-Putin summit in Alaska concerning Ukraine peace remained a primary focus for US media throughout the day. Early reports speculating on territorial concessions were later countered by Ukrainian President Zelenskyy's firm rejections of ceding land. By late day, European allies and Ukraine voiced unease about being sidelined in these discussions. Domestically, the evolving shooting incident near Emory University and CDC headquarters in Atlanta dominated initial headlines, with reports confirming an officer's death and later identifying the assailant. Concurrently, attention expanded to President Trump's domestic policy shifts. This included the replacement of the IRS Commissioner, a new executive order on federal grants, and a significant reversal of an immigration 'quiet amnesty,' alongside ongoing scrutiny of his administration's financial dealings.

The day saw the Security Cabinet's approval of the Gaza conquest plan, despite early warnings from security chiefs who stressed hostage risks. International diplomatic efforts by the US and Qatar intensified in the morning, focusing on preventing full Israeli occupation and securing a hostage deal, with reports highlighting President Trump's direct involvement. As the day progressed, pressure mounted from hostage families, who called for a national economic shutdown and issued stark warnings to Prime Minister Netanyahu regarding his responsibility for captives' lives during the takeover. The day culminated with Finance Minister Smotrich's public declaration of having "lost faith" in Netanyahu's capacity or will to achieve a decisive Gaza victory, criticizing the cabinet's approved operation as "immoral foolishness" intended only for pressure, not true success or hostage return. This signaled a significant internal political challenge.

German media continued prioritizing the confirmed Trump-Putin summit in Alaska on August 15th, a key development from the previous day. Discussions throughout the morning focused on Trump's floating of a "territorial exchange" for Ukraine, which President Zelenskyy swiftly rejected. As the day progressed, reports detailed Russia's reported request for Ukraine to concede regions like Donezk and Luhansk, met with Ukraine's firm refusal. Western representatives convened for pre-summit meetings, and later, Europeans presented a counter-proposal to Moscow's ceasefire plan. Concurrently, Chancellor Merz's decision to halt arms exports to Israel remained a contentious issue, causing rifts within the government and drawing criticism. In the evening, a significant local tragedy emerged, with reports of a carbon monoxide poisoning incident at a private gathering in Munich resulting in one fatality and several injuries, dominating late-day coverage.

French media extensively covered the anticipated Trump-Putin summit in Alaska, with morning reports detailing proposed Ukrainian territorial exchanges and President Zelensky's firm rejection. This narrative evolved as President Macron later reiterated that Ukraine's future must be decided by its people, emphasizing the need for European coordination. Domestically, the escalating heatwave remained a primary concern, expanding orange alerts across southern France, while the severe Aude wildfire continued to burn, with firefighters battling challenging conditions. In the early afternoon, a significant new development emerged as French justice issued an international arrest warrant for an Algerian diplomat involved in a kidnapping case in Paris. By evening, international attention shifted to large protests in Tel Aviv, with demonstrators gathering against Benjamin Netanyahu's Gaza occupation plan and demanding the return of hostages.

Lebanese media on August 9th continued extensive coverage of the government's pursuit of an arms monopoly and state authority, extending from the August 7th session's fallout. Early reports discussed the Shiite Duo's position and Iran's influence on Hezbollah's armaments, alongside army warnings against street protests.A major shift occurred by late morning with news of an ammunition explosion in South Lebanon, causing multiple casualties among Lebanese troops. While some reports attributed it to Israeli ordnance remnants, others, notably Kataeb, specified the blast happened during the dismantling of Hezbollah missiles.This incident intensified the sovereignty debate. An Iranian official subsequently urged Lebanese figures to prevent Hezbollah's disarmament. In a direct diplomatic challenge, the Lebanese Foreign Ministry strongly condemned this interference, asserting that Lebanon's future and political system are exclusively Lebanese decisions. This rejection highlighted Beirut's firm stance against external meddling.

The day's Ukrainian media was dominated by President Zelensky's firm rejection of any "territorial exchange" with Russia, a direct response to proposals that surfaced on previous days. This unequivocal stance underscored Ukraine's commitment not to cede land to occupiers. Concurrently, a significant military development saw SBU drones strike a 'Shahed' storage terminal deep within Tatarstan, highlighting Ukraine's capacity for long-range operations. By afternoon, the diplomatic focus shifted as Ukraine and its European partners presented their own demands and peace plan to the US, setting "red lines" for any negotiations with Russia. This proactive move aimed to define the terms for potential talks with Putin, especially ahead of the anticipated Trump-Putin summit, where Ukraine sought to ensure its interests were centrally represented, with late reports even suggesting a possible invitation for Zelensky to Alaska.

Palestinian media extensively reported on Gaza's deepening humanitarian crisis, detailing mounting famine-related deaths, casualties among aid seekers, and widespread destruction. Against this backdrop, coverage intensified on Israel's proposed Gaza occupation plan, which faced significant internal dissent throughout the day. Reports highlighted opposition from Israeli security leadership and a prominent minister, alongside large-scale protests in Tel Aviv demanding a ceasefire and criticizing the prime minister's war conduct.
Simultaneously, intensive diplomatic efforts gained prominence, with US and Qatari envoys meeting to discuss a plan to end the war. Mediators reportedly raced against time to secure a deal, underscoring persistent threats of a renewed Israeli invasion of Gaza City.

The day's editorial focus began with the confirmed Trump-Putin meeting in Alaska, a development anticipated from prior days' reports. Throughout the morning, UK media highlighted Ukrainian President Zelensky's firm rejection of territorial concessions, a direct counter to earlier suggestions of land swaps. By mid-day, domestic attention pivoted sharply to widespread Palestine Action protests in central London. Reports detailed escalating police arrests of supporters, with numbers increasing significantly throughout the afternoon and into the evening. Concurrently, international coverage continued on Ukraine, as European leaders pushed their own peace initiatives and discussions emerged regarding a potential invitation for Kyiv to the Alaska summit, reinforcing the diplomatic complexities surrounding the conflict.

Iranian media primarily focused on the nation's assertive stance against perceived US influence in the Caucasus. Throughout the afternoon, senior officials, including Velayati and a Khamenei advisor, explicitly declared Iran's intent to block any American-backed corridor in the region, particularly the Zangezur corridor, with or without Russian cooperation. This was framed as preventing "Trump's path" and described as a "graveyard for mercenaries." Concurrently, the passing of renowned artist Mahmoud Farshchian dominated domestic cultural news, with extensive coverage of his legacy. Official Pezeshkian's public statements emphasizing national unity and praising journalists continued across various outlets. Regional security remained a consistent concern, with ongoing speculation about a future Iran-Israel missile conflict and continued condemnations of Israel's Gaza City occupation plan. Domestically, economic challenges persisted, alongside reports of judiciary allegations against individuals accused of spying for Mossad.

Russian media on August 9 consistently prioritized the confirmed August 15 Putin-Trump summit in Alaska, building on previous days' summit preparations. Early reports highlighted President Trump's statements regarding Ukraine's territorial considerations and the conflict's potential escalation. As the day progressed, editorial attention shifted to Ukraine's role, with some outlets interpreting Alaska as a signal for Ukraine to surrender or suggesting Kyiv's exclusion from initial talks, even as President Zelensky warned against decisions without Ukraine. By afternoon, a significant development emerged: reports of Ukraine and the EU presenting an alternative or counter-proposal for conflict resolution, explicitly for the upcoming negotiations. This indicated a new layer of diplomatic engagement surrounding the anticipated summit.

Italian newspapers primarily focused on the confirmed August 15 Trump-Putin summit in Alaska, initially highlighting a proposed "territory exchange" for peace, a direct continuation from yesterday's news. Throughout the day, Ukrainian President Zelensky's firm rejection of ceding land without Kyiv's involvement was consistently reported. A key development emerged with reports indicating the White House was evaluating inviting Zelensky to the summit, despite his earlier exclusion. Concurrently, European and Kyiv's joint counter-proposal for a peace deal gained prominence, emphasizing a truce as a prerequisite before any territorial changes. This aligned with statements from Meloni and other European leaders asserting no peace without Ukraine's consent. Separately, international opposition to Israel's Gaza occupation plan escalated, with Italy among a growing number of nations condemning it. Domestically, the mobilization of national civil protection for a fire on Mount Vesuvius became a notable report.

Japanese media focused significantly on evolving international diplomatic efforts regarding Ukraine. The day began with reports confirming an August 15th US-Russia summit in Alaska, initially suggesting proposed peace deals included Ukrainian territorial concessions. However, later in the morning, reports highlighted Ukraine's rejection of these terms. By the afternoon, the narrative shifted as President Trump was reported to propose a "territory exchange" ahead of the summit, signaling a new direction in the peace talks. Concurrently, the 80th anniversary of the Nagasaki atomic bombing remained a prominent editorial priority, with widespread coverage reflecting on the historical event and advocating for peace, continuing a theme from Hiroshima's anniversary. Domestic concerns also featured, including growing anger over taxation and calls for tax cuts, alongside local reports of heavy rain and linear rain bands.

Dutch media on August 9 closely tracked converging narratives around US foreign policy and the Israel-Gaza conflict. Morning reports highlighted the upcoming August 15 meeting between Trump and Putin in Alaska, signaling a significant shift in US-Russia relations. Concurrently, Zelensky's swift rejection of any Trump-proposed peace plan involving territorial concessions to Russia became a leading story across several outlets. By afternoon, analyses detailed Trump's pivot from sanction threats to direct dialogue with Putin.
Throughout the day, editorial focus remained strongly on Gaza, with reports emphasizing the ongoing humanitarian crisis and the inadequacy of current aid efforts. Newspapers also highlighted Prime Minister Netanyahu’s stance, characterizing him as increasingly radicalized and risking an endless cycle of violence, while others explored the power of images from Gaza in shaping public opinion.

The day's editorial priority overwhelmingly centered on the Indian Air Force Chief's unprecedented revelations concerning "Operation Sindoor." Mid-morning reports detailed the shooting down of 5-6 Pakistani fighter jets and an AEW&C aircraft, attributing success to the S-400 system and political resolve. This disclosure became the dominant narrative, drawing further clarification on operational details, sharp denial from Pakistan, and questions from the Congress party. Concurrently, the US-India trade dispute remained a notable story. While early coverage included President Trump's remarks on trade deals and tariff impacts, India also endorsed the upcoming Trump-Putin summit in Alaska as a potential step toward Ukraine peace. Domestically, severe monsoon rains caused widespread flooding in Delhi-NCR, and anti-terror operations in J&K resulted in two soldiers killed.

The KPO crisis continued to dominate Polish media on August 9th, with reports detailing its deepening impact. Initial morning coverage highlighted the ongoing controversy and alleged irregularities in fund distribution, alongside President Nawrocki's political sparring with the government. By mid-morning, editorial attention prominently shifted to the confirmed meeting between President Nawrocki and US President Donald Trump, signaling a significant development in Polish-US relations and amplifying Nawrocki's active early presidency. In the afternoon, the KPO scandal re-escalated, with Prime Minister Tusk expressing outrage and vowing consequences, while the opposition filed formal complaints. Late in the day, a new, critical revelation emerged, suggesting that the distributed KPO funds were drawn from the state budget, not direct EU disbursements, intensifying the controversy. International news also featured Ukraine and Europe presenting new peace proposals.

On August 9th, Spanish media prioritized two main evolving narratives. The confirmed summit between President Trump and Vladimir Putin for August 15th in Alaska to negotiate peace in Ukraine dominated international coverage throughout the day, following earlier reports of Trump's mediation efforts. Domestically, the aftermath of the Cordoba Mosque fire became a central focus. Initial reports of the fire being extinguished in the morning gave way to significant developments later, with news of a chapel roof collapse and damage assessments, leading to comparisons with the Notre Dame fire. By late afternoon, reports detailed the specific area of damage and the mosque's reopening, alongside discussions of fire prevention plans. Separately, the Israel-Gaza conflict continued to be reported, with Israel's approved occupation plan for Gaza City featuring in early coverage.

Turkish media attention on August 9 primarily focused on the evolving Gaza conflict. Diplomatic efforts intensified throughout the day, beginning with Foreign Minister Fidan's meetings in Egypt. President Erdoğan held phone discussions with Azerbaijani President Aliyev and later with Palestinian President Abbas concerning the Gaza situation. These high-level engagements culminated in the evening with significant public demonstrations in Istanbul, where citizens marched in solidarity with Gaza. Domestically, reports in the morning continued to cover the Çanakkale forest fire, indicating it was largely brought under control after extensive overnight efforts, with damage assessment initiating. By late morning, a new development in education policy emerged as YÖK announced revised admission thresholds for law faculties, a decision that garnered considerable media attention. Concurrently, discussions around the "Terror-Free Türkiye" committee continued, underscoring ongoing security priorities.

Chinese state media on August 9th prominently featured President Xi Jinping's ongoing ideological guidance, particularly his vision for "Chinese-style modernization." Early reports and AI overviews highlighted the critical balance between material and spiritual civilization, emphasizing public well-being and national fitness—a continuation of themes from previous days regarding the Party's strategic direction.
Concurrently, consistent coverage detailed President Xi's phone call with Russian President Putin on Ukraine peace talks, with international reports adding context on a potential Trump-Putin summit. Throughout the day, state media also reported on all-out rescue efforts following severe floods in Gansu. Economic news noted flat consumer prices in July, evolving into discussions about long-term tariff implications and China's demand. The narrative consistently underscored the Party's comprehensive approach to national development.
